摘要
Three grades of pasteurized milk (A, B and C) are currently available in the Brazilian market. Due to differences in the hygienic and sanitary conditions during production, the resulting load of viable bacteria in each type of pasteurized milk is different, being A<B<C. The influence of the microbiological quality on the performance of two rapid and easy-to-perforin analytical systems (Petrifilm(TM) AC and Simplate(TM) TPC plates) for enumeration of total viable bacteria in pasteurized milk was evaluated. The standard plate count procedure, using standard methods agar (SMA), was used as the reference method. A clear relationship between milk grade and performance of Petrifilm(TM) AC was observed: regression analysis indicated that correlation coefficient (r) values were 0.852, 0.770 and 0.693 for milk grades A, B and C, respectively, and 0.878 when samples were evaluated globally. For Simplate(TM) TPC plates, this relationship was less evident, because r values correlating counts in these plates and SMA were too low. (C) 2002 Elsevier Science Ltd. All rights reserved.
